Explore America’s Home of Space Exploration
Dive into the incredible world of space travel at NASA’s Kennedy Space Center Visitor Complex. As the primary launch site for human spaceflight, this renowned destination lets you experience firsthand the challenges and wonders of space exploration.
A Universe of Experiences Awaits
Marvel at authentic rockets in the Rocket Garden, each representing milestones in America’s journey to the stars. Step inside immersive exhibitions like Heroes & Legends and discover the inspirational stories of astronauts who helped shape space history. The U.S. Astronaut Hall of Fame honors their courage and achievements with interactive displays that bring the drama of space missions to life.
Get Up Close with Space Shuttle Atlantis
Stand mere feet away from Space Shuttle Atlantis, spectacularly displayed to highlight one of NASA’s crowning achievements. Try out the Shuttle Launch Experience and feel what it’s like to embark on a journey beyond Earth’s atmosphere. This realistic simulator offers a thrilling taste of shuttle flight, creating a memorable highlight for all visitors.
Live Science and Innovation
Watch captivating 3D space films that dive into the wonders of our solar system and humanity’s dreams for the future. Attend live presentations by space experts and engage with interactive shows that explain the mysteries of flight and engineering. Special activities for families ensure exciting learning opportunities for guests of all ages.
Exciting Extras and New Frontiers
The Kennedy Space Center continues to offer new adventures. Young explorers can discover, climb and play at Planet Play, a multi-story indoor play area designed for aspiring astronauts. Tech enthusiasts can secure onsite reservations for the immersive Hyperdeck VR Experience, venturing into virtual adventures that stretch the imagination.
Memorials and History
Reflect at the Astronaut Memorial, built to honor the men and women who have given their lives pursuing space exploration. Take time to visit the gantry at Launch Complex 39, the historic launch site for many renowned NASA missions.

What are the main attractions included with admission?
General admission grants access to exhibits like Space Shuttle Atlantis, the Rocket Garden, Heroes & Legends, live presentations and more.
Can I see a live rocket launch with my ticket?
Rocket launches are viewable when scheduled but are not guaranteed on the day of your visit. Check the launch calendar in advance.
Is the Kennedy Space Center wheelchair accessible?
Yes, the complex is fully accessible for visitors using wheelchairs and with other mobility needs.
How long should I plan to spend at the Visitor Complex?
Allow at least a full day to explore all exhibitions, shows and attractions included with your ticket.
